Celebrate culture, tradition, and handmade beauty at the monthly Native Arts & Crafts Pop-Up hosted by Denakkanaaga at the Morris Thompson Cultural and Visitors Center!
Every second Friday, the heart of downtown Fairbanks comes alive with vibrant displays of authentic Alaska Native beadwork, leatherwork, carvings, tools, art, and more. Whether you’re searching for a one-of-a-kind gift or just want to connect with local artists and elders, this pop-up is filled with stories, craftsmanship, and community spirit.
